Segmental ischaemic infarction of the iris after autologous fat injection into the lower eyelid tissue: a case report [PDF]
Autologous fat injection is getting popular in cosmetic procedures, however, still has a risk of fat embolism. Herein, we report the first case of segmental ischaemic infarction of the iris, which occurred after autologous fat injection into the lower eyelid.A 28-year-old Korean woman complained of the discolouration of the iris after the fat injection.
